Wigner functions for paraxial and nonparaxial fields

, &
Pages 1843-1852 | Received 10 Sep 2009, Accepted 28 Sep 2009, Published online: 02 Nov 2009
 

Abstract

The Wigner function gives an intuitive representation of coherent and partially coherent wave fields in the frequency domain, which takes the form a ray weight distribution. However, this weight distribution is conserved along rays only for paraxial or significantly incoherent fields. Generalizations of the Wigner function have been defined for propagation through transparent homogeneous media that are exactly conserved along rays for any angular spread and state of coherence. A series expression is derived here for calculating these nonparaxial generalizations starting from the standard Wigner function.
